Just how tight is the fit on these? I'm 6'2", 185-190lbs, normally wear a 35 waist/ 33 inseam if available (34-36 waist, 32-34 inseam in various brands/cuts), hip measurement is right around 42" and crotch to ankle is ~31". The vast majority of ski pants feel a little overly baggy to me, but I'm also not looking for the plum smuggler/skin tight super alpine fit many of the softshell touring pants seem to have.
Is the large going to give enough room to feel comfy w/ a 260 weight merino base and enough length to maintain coverage down below the second boot buckle through full range of motion. Is the XL a possible fit w/o requiring extreme belting and/or suspenders and general bagginess?

Turns out the larges fit almost exactly how I want them, almost like my favorite jeans but w/ enhanced range of motion through the hips and crotch and more flare in the lower leg to accommodate the boot. If I lived in a world of limitless credit lines and free return shipping, I'd probably opt for the Large Tall for skiing. Length in the regular seems sufficient to allay any deep seated fears of kids making fun of my highwaters in the lift lines however, and also means that I'm not tripping over or dragging the cuffs around when I'm wearing street or hiking shoes. The cuffs and gaiters also seem to do a really good job of staying put. They seem like they might be pretty nice for cold weather backpacking as well as long as I don't get too close to the campfire. Hey Sid, The pants are cut so that they flare out at the bottom. I have had no problems fitting them over 28.5 downhill boots (Dalebello Rampage) or my AT boots, 28 Scarpa Maestrales. I have noticed snow getting past the gaiter in deeper snow because it is not extremely snug, although this is more of a problem with my AT boots which are less burly. The pants come with suspenders which are removable. I think XL will be too big for you, and recommend the large based on the dimensions you give. For reference, I am 6'2" (inseam 32"), 175# (waist 32") and the medium long fit me very well, and also give enough room for a thin pair of fleece pants or medium weight merino base layer.

Sid N. The Snowtastic Pant is a more fitted pant and not so baggy as other ski pants on the market. I would call this more of a traditional alpine fit that is perfect for backcountry skiing and even some climbing. It sounds like your measurements would dictate that a large would fit you just about right. If you want them to be slightly more baggy and don't mind some "belting", albeit not extreme, you would probably do fine with an XL as well. I hope this info helps!

Tech Specs:
- Material:
- [membrane/laminate] Dry.Q Elite; [shell] twill softshell 3L (56% polyester, 44% nylon), DWR coating
- Fabric Waterproof Rating:
- 40,000 mm
- Fabric Breathability Rating:
- 30,000 g/mē
- Insulation:
- none
- Fit:
- regular
- Venting:
- side vents
- Side Zips:
- yes, 3/4 length
- Gaiters:
- yes
- Seams:
- sonic welded
- Waist:
- removable suspenders, belt loops with button closure
- Pockets:
- 2 hand
- Recommended Use:
- skiing, touring
- Manufacturer Warranty:
- lifetime
